August 1 – September 5, 2009Opening Reception: Saturday, August 1st
4pm-9pmSan Francisco, July 2009 – Summer
time is the perfect season for casual introductions, and the opening of Annual Biennial on August 1, 2009 at Michael
Rosenthal Gallery is the ideal place to meet an array of artists
from the Bay Area and beyond. Featuring over 30 artists, Annual Biennial,
the month long group exhibition,
presents work by Michael Rosenthal gallery artists Megan Whitmarsh,
Amy Casey, Lisa Adams, Inga Dorosz, Jane Fine, Veronica De Jesus, and
Elizabeth Mooney, in addition to a variety of artists in the gallery’s
flat-file collection, including Carrie Mae Weems, Bruce Nauman, Cindy
Sherman, and James Rosenquist. Gallery owner Michael Rosenthal views
Annual Biennial as an opportunity to celebrate the growth of his
nearly one-year old San Francisco gallery, as well as the artists with
whom the gallery works and those it represents. “This is a great collectors
show, and a great show for the gallery,” notes Rosenthal, “as it
allows us to showcase a portion of the gallery’s treasure trove of
works in a really playful manner.” Displaying between 2 and 5 works apiece, primarily paintings and drawings, Rosenthal’s Annual Biennial artists, akin to a mélange of interesting party guests, each take on a space of there own, commanding conversation and contemplation. The salon style hanging of the exhibition brings together a ‘back-to-the-basics’, crisp, colorful curation of works, and firmly positions Michael Rosenthal Gallery as one of San Francisco’s newest galleries to keep a future eye on. 365 Valencia Street

Michael Rosenthal focuses on innovative gallery programming, and
exhibiting work by emerging and established artists. In September
2008, Michael Rosenthal opened at 365 Valencia Street, San Francisco.
The gallery actively participates in major national and international
art fairs, including: Bridge (London), Red Dot (Miami), Aqua (Miami),
Art Now (NYC) and Art21 (Cologne).
